Weekly Market Update November 15-21

Faris Team CEO and Broker, Mark Faris, says that buyers should take note: even though new listings in Barrie and area are once again down this week, New Tecumseth saw an increase in supply. More inventory gives a margin of breathing room to buyers here as well as in Southern Georgian Bay, where Midland and area markets are also averaging more new inventory than sales in the past week.

Greater Barrie Area

Compared to the week of November 8-14:

  • Average selling price is $664K, down 1%  

  • 20% fewer new listings than last week

  • 10% fewer homes sold

  • List-to-sale ratio is steady at 101.4%


Midland & Surrounding Area

Compared to the week of November 8-14:

  • Average selling price is $616K, down 1%  

  • 66% more new listings than last week

  • 32% fewer homes sold

  • List-to-sale ratio is down to 99.1 %


Orillia & Surrounding Area

Compared to the week of November 8-14:

  • Average selling price is $660K, down 7%  

  • 13% more new listings

  • 13% more homes sold

  • List-to-sale ratio is down slightly to 99.6%
